Tiivistelmä:An incentive problem in participative budgeting occurs when worker has private information about the factors that influence his or her performance and the pay scheme is budget or standard-based. This information, if communicated accurately by the worker, may be valuable to a manager for planning and control purposes.However, the worker has an incentive to bias its communication. To alleviate this problem truth-inducing pay schemes are proposed, that provide incentive for accurately communicating private information and maximizing performance.
